The Anatomy of a Premium Design Asset
Understanding the technical versatility of your assets is crucial for a smooth design workflow. This collection is engineered for professional use, offering 9 distinct torn shapes derived from 20 unique paper textures. Each tape is delivered as a high-resolution PNG file up to 10.8 inches by 2.9 inches, featuring a transparent background. This transparency is not just a technical specification; it is a gateway to creative flexibility. Designers can utilize the tapes as-is for a flat, matte look or adjust the opacity and blending modes to mimic the translucent, glossy effect of real cello tape. This adaptability makes the set compatible with various color palettes and composition styles.
Practical Applications Across Industries
The utility of torn washi tape extends far beyond traditional scrapbook pages. In modern visual design, these elements serve as powerful tools for directing the viewer's eye and establishing a visual hierarchy. Here is how you can integrate these assets into different creative domains:
- Brand Identity and Logo Design: Use the gold-scattered textures to create rustic, artisanal brand marks. The torn edges convey a sense of authenticity and craftsmanship, perfect for eco-friendly brands or boutique businesses looking to establish a unique brand identity.
- Social Media Graphics: In the realm of digital marketing, stopping the scroll is paramount. These tapes can be used to highlight discount codes, frame testimonials, or create "pinned" note effects on Instagram stories and Pinterest pins, adding a layer of engagement that flat colors cannot achieve.
- Web and UI Design: While UI design often favors minimalism, textured elements can enhance user experience when used sparingly. These tapes work beautifully as dividers, bookmark ribbons, or accent elements in lifestyle blogs and e-commerce sites, contributing to a warm modern aesthetic.
- Packaging and Editorial Design: For packaging design, the gold flecks in the texture add a premium feel without the cost of metallic foiling. In editorial design, use them to anchor pull quotes or separate columns, guiding the reader through the layout with intuitive visual cues.
